  • Patent number: 11949048
    Abstract: According to one embodiment, an illumination device comprises a first mounting board including a plurality of first light emitting elements, a second mounting board including a plurality of second light emitting elements, and a first wiring board including a first wiring line electrically connected to at least one of the plurality of first light emitting elements and the plurality of second light emitting elements. The first mounting board and the second mounting board extend in a first direction and are arranged along a second direction intersecting the first direction. The first wiring board is superposed on the first mounting board and the second mounting board. The first wiring board has rigidity that is lower than rigidity of each of the first mounting board and the second mounting board.

  • Patent number: 11782299
    Abstract: According to one embodiment, a display device includes a sheet-like display panel having a first area, second and third areas, and a support substrate bonded to the display panel. The support substrate has a first support portion overlapping the first area, second and third support portions overlapping the second area, fourth and fifth support portions overlapping the third area, a first groove between the first and second support portions, a second groove between the second and third support portions, a third groove between the first and fourth support portions, and a fourth groove between the fourth and fifth support portions. The first and second grooves extend along the second direction. The third and fourth grooves extend along a first direction.

  • Publication number: 20220179258
    Abstract: According to one embodiment, a casing accommodating a display panel and a illumination device includes a bottom portion supporting the illumination device, a first edge part and a second edge part, a third edge part extending along a first direction at a position between the first edge part and the second edge part, a first locking portion provided at the first edge part, and a second locking portion provided at the second edge part, wherein a first adhesive member adheres the display panel to the first locking portion, a second adhesive member adheres the display panel to the second locking portion.

  • Patent number: 11256118
    Abstract: According to one embodiment, a display device includes a display panel including a display surface and a rear surface located in an opposite side to the display surface, a support plate including a first main surface opposing the rear surface of the display panel, a second main surface located in an opposite side to the first main surface and a first opening opposing at least a central portion of the display panel, and an adhesive tape disposed on the second main surface so as to be overlaid on the first opening, and including a first adhesive region attached on the second main surface around the first opening and a second adhesive region located in the first opening and attached on the rear surface of the display panel.

  • Publication number: 20140015873
    Abstract: According to one embodiment, there is provided a second block that is connectable via an interface cable to a first block serving as a signal source, and supplies a high-resolution display with image data of a high resolution. The second block has an information transmitter for transmitting particular resolution information different from the high resolution when the resolution information of the high-resolution display is transmitted to the first block. The second block also has an image decoder for decoding, into image data of the high resolution, the image data processed based on the particular resolution information and sent from the first block. The decoded high-resolution image data is output to the high-resolution display.

  • Patent number: 7545628
    Abstract: In a display panel mounted on a display device, a configuration of mounting that realizes decrease in thickness and weight and exhibits high reliability as well. The display panel is provided with a screen, a plastic frame supporting at least part of the outer periphery of a surface light source device, and a metallic frame disposed on the outside of the plastic frame. On the plastic frame, bosses for fixing the display panel are formed. The metallic frame is furnished at the positions opposite the bosses with holes that allow insertion of screws for fixing the display panel. The display panel is fixed to the outer cover of the display device by causing the fixing screws to be fastened by screwing into the bosses formed on the plastic frame of the display panel.

  • Patent number: 5161028
    Abstract: In this invention, a first slider is slidably provided in a holding part provided in a housing part within a car, a second slider is further slidably provided along this first slider and a liquid crystal display is rotatably provided through a hinge at the tip of this second slider. Further, an engaging means is provided on said housing part and second slider so that, when the liquid crystal display is housed, the above mentioned display, second slider and first slider may be disengageably housed within the above mentioned holding part by the above mentioned engaging means and the liquid crystal display may be always kept energized in the sliding direction by the energizing means and, when the liquid crystal display is to be used, it may be easy to move in the sliding direction by the energizing force.
